It is extremely important that we remain focused on the application of air conditioning systems in which the consumption of electrical energy is minimized more aggressively to reduce greenhouse gases.
In recent days, the world press has placed great emphasis on the meeting organized by President Emmanuel Macron of France, which commemorated the first two years of the Paris Agreement, very similar to those organized by the United Nations. The electricity industry has presented arguments that arouse interest in developing projects related to renewable energy. On the other hand, they show a gradual decrease in investment and financing of sectors such as generation using oil or gas.
All these companies, with financial capacity for this type of investment are being very selective. There is currently a trend towards financing and investing in projects where electricity is generated with cleaner energy. According to experts, it is not necessarily an ecological decision, but they want to ensure that their future investments or the projects they finance do not result in economic failures or lose value.
This condition is present in the most developed countries such as the United States and the European Union that also have very old and therefore inefficient electricity generation plants. In the least developed countries, where the most important goal is to provide electricity to the people, the World Bank contributes financially to these projects and for some time decided not to get involved in hydrocarbon-related projects.
Investments in making existing generating plants more efficient and minimizing CO₂ emissions, as well as new cleaner plants where renewable resources are applied, are very expensive. Therefore, our contribution as engineers by applying more efficient air conditioning systems to reduce electrical energy consumption is very important, especially in our tropical countries, where air conditioning is the largest consumer.
As I have mentioned in many of the previous writings, the ideal application of air conditioning is in which the three fluids: air, water and refrigerant are variable and adapt to the thermal load at all times. Remember that the thermal load fluctuates during the operation of the air conditioning system and very little percentage of the time it runs at maximum capacity. When this happens is when, using variable frequency drives, all the components of the air conditioning system are regulated to coordinate and optimize their operation through the control system. This acts as a conductor achieving harmony between the components and therefore reducing electricity consumption.
